ICYMI, today, March 14, is Pi Day—an annual celebration of the mathematical constant (the ratio of the circumference of a circle to its diameter). Represented by pi (Greek letter “π”), it equals about 3.14159, hence why math enthusiasts—and dessert lovers—honor it every year on this day.
